Output 40a8895106a7b6308a7ef8005b31792ffb0d6c4109228562fb00ed0e3fd47aae:1

value
51780284
script pubkey
OP_0 OP_PUSHBYTES_20 eef8e93ec41e1d9523be004de2987e6dfa709bc5
address
bc1qamuwj0kyrcwe2ga7qpx79xr7dha8px79lwzwkh
transaction
40a8895106a7b6308a7ef8005b31792ffb0d6c4109228562fb00ed0e3fd47aae
spent
true